A leading security solution company in Greater London is seeking a detail-focused CAD Technician to support the design and delivery of security projects. The ideal candidate will produce accurate technical drawings using AutoCAD and manage project documentation.

With a hybrid work model, this role offers the flexibility to work from home or the Crawley or Letchworth offices. The position includes access to career development and a competitive salary with benefits.

How to prepare for a job interview at Johnson Controls

Know Your CAD Software Inside Out

Make sure you're well-versed in AutoCAD and any other relevant software. Brush up on your technical skills and be ready to discuss specific projects where you've used these tools. This will show your potential employer that you’re not just familiar with the software, but that you can leverage it effectively in real-world scenarios.

Showcase Your Attention to Detail

As a CAD Technician, attention to detail is crucial. Prepare examples of how your meticulous nature has positively impacted past projects. Whether it’s catching errors in designs or ensuring documentation is spot-on, highlight these experiences to demonstrate your fit for the role.

Understand Security Project Requirements

Familiarise yourself with the specific needs of security projects. Research common challenges and solutions in the industry. Being able to discuss how you can contribute to the design and delivery of security solutions will set you apart from other candidates.

Prepare for Hybrid Work Discussions

Since this role offers a hybrid work model, be ready to discuss how you manage your time and productivity when working remotely. Share strategies you’ve used in the past to stay organised and communicate effectively with team members, whether in the office or at home.
